Internal memo — sample shipments to Greywick Analytical. Coordinator: three insulated cases of Larkspur project samples ship each Tuesday and Friday from the Holloway annex. Assign drivers familiar with cold-chain handling; transit time must stay under four hours. Cases remain sealed end to end, and the temperature logger stays inside each case. Verify the manifest count with the packer before departure. For the transfer at the lab, follow the confidential hand-over instruction below.

drop instructions, yafog-yawip: the quenmir olidor courier leaves the julox tamion keliel ledger at gate 5283 under passcode 336825

// Tracing client setup. Read before touching.
// Every service in the Fernhollow stack propagates trace context
// via the Lanternline collector. Spans flow: gateway -> service ->
// Lanternline. No manual span IDs — the client generates them.
// Drop the middleware and traces silently break downstream, so
// keep it first in the chain. Sampling is 10% in prod, 100% in
// staging. The client auths to Lanternline with the key below:

gateway credential: kto23_dolYgAScEh2TaPOlStqOl98

# TaxCacheLite — tax-rate lookup cache for Fennmark plugin authors.
# This file configures how cached jurisdiction rates are fetched and refreshed.
# Plugin authors should never hardcode rates; always read through the cache layer.
# Set TAXCACHE_REGION and TAXCACHE_TTL_SECONDS above before enabling sync.
# The rate-sync service authenticates with a credential, which is set on the following line.

vault entry, yahif-yajep: COURIER_KEY29=b802bdf8034096b65a51c6ba5abe2